Wake Forest Deacons vs North Carolina Tarheels Bad Beat College Football Picks

Our bad beat of the week this week is Wake Forest’s (+2.5) monumental collapse against the North Carolina Tarheels on Saturday. If you followed my college football picks on Saturday, which for your bank account’s sake I hope you did not, you know I had Wake money line in this one. Even though this one hits close to home, I will do my best to keep emotion out of it while breaking it down. 

Wake Forest could do no wrong through the first three and quarters of football on Saturday. Sure their defense wasn’t playing the best, but UNC has a high flying offense so giving up points was expected. Their offense was humming and at the 7:38 mark of the third quarter, they found themselves leading 45-27. The Tarheels added a score to cut it to an 11 point lead, but Wake responded with a field goal with about a minute left in the quarter. The Demon Deacons took a two touchdown lead into the fourth.

Now this is where the wheels totally fell off. UNC head coach Mac Brown must have put the fear of God into this team in between quarters, because this was a new team in the fourth. Former Vol–salt in the wound–Ty Chandler ran for 125 and three scores in the final quarter alone.

One of Chandler’s touchdowns came about four minutes into the quarter to cut the lead to seven. This is when I started sweating. He added his second touchdown of the quarter just a minute later to tie the game. This is when I knew the game was over. 

Wake turned it over on downs and UNC methodically marched down the field and added a go-ahead field goal. Still 2:12 left, but not a lot of hope. The Deacs got the ball back but quickly turned it over on downs again. Then, almost as if to spite me, Chandler takes a 50 yard run to the house to give the Tarheels a 10 point lead with a minute remaining. 

Wake added a garbage time touchdown just to prove Vegas right, and North Carolina left with a three point victory. I couldn’t believe my eyes. A game that was cruising for 75% of the game turned to a loss in the blink of an eye. I hate college football. But obviously I’ll be back next week ready to get my heart ripped out again.
